gpt4 book ai didi

php - move_uploaded_file 无法打开流 : Permission denied - Mac

转载 作者:IT王子 更新时间:2023-10-29 00:11:17 26 4
gpt4 key购买 nike

当我尝试使用以下代码在 php 中移动上传文件时:

if(is_uploaded_file($_FILES['fileupload2']['tmp_name'])){

move_uploaded_file($_FILES['fileupload2']['tmp_name'], "images/".$_FILES['fileupload2']['name']);

}

我有这个错误说:

Warning: move_uploaded_file(images/VIDEO_TS.VOB): failed to open stream: Permission denied in /Applications/XAMPP/xamppfiles/htdocs/Week3/Lesson2/do_upload.php on line 24

我在终端上试过但没有成功:

sudo CHMOD 775 /Applications/XAMPP/xamppfiles/htdocs/Week3/Lesson2/do_upload.php 

sudo chmod -R 0755 /Applications/XAMPP/xamppfiles/htdocs/Week3/Lesson2/do_upload.php

sudo chown nobody /Applications/XAMPP/xamppfiles/htdocs/Week3/Lesson2/do_upload.php

我仍然遇到错误,我正在使用 Yosemite,还有其他解决方案吗?

最佳答案

我的解决方案是通过转到文件 > 右键单击​​ > 获取信息 > 然后将所有权限更改为 read&write 来授予图像文件夹和 php 文件的权限,如下图所示.

enter image description here

关于php - move_uploaded_file 无法打开流 : Permission denied - Mac,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31915957/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com